Factors That Affect Moped Insurance Costs
The cost of insurance for mopeds varies depending on several factors. These include:
- Age of the rider
- Location of the rider
- Type of moped
- Driving record of the rider
- Coverage options chosen by the rider
Age of the Rider
Youthful riders are considered high-risk by insurers, and they are more likely to be involved in accidents. Therefore, insurance premiums for young riders are higher than for older riders.
Location of the Rider
Insurance rates for mopeds also vary depending on where you live. If you live in an area with a high crime rate or heavy traffic, your insurance premiums will be higher.
Type of Moped
The type of moped you own also affects insurance costs. High-performance mopeds are more expensive to insure than low-performance mopeds.
Driving Record of the Rider
If you have a history of accidents or moving violations, you will pay more for insurance than a rider with a clean driving record.
Coverage Options Chosen by the Rider
The coverage options you choose will also affect your insurance premiums. A basic liability policy will cost less than a comprehensive policy that includes collision and theft coverage.
How Much Does Moped Insurance Cost?
The cost of insurance for mopeds in 2023 varies depending on the factors mentioned above. On average, however, a basic liability policy for a moped costs around $100 to $300 per year. A comprehensive policy that includes collision and theft coverage can cost up to $500 per year.
Tips for Reducing Moped Insurance Costs
Here are some tips to help you reduce your moped insurance costs:
- Take a defensive driving course
- Choose a low-performance moped
- Keep your driving record clean
- Compare insurance quotes from multiple providers
- Bundle your moped insurance with other policies, such as home or auto insurance
